Output 579e60d5ef9ed6fd518347bb8c72fc24b772705f3ac32e63d11829d1b6f222e6:0

value
19541428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9861e96f5687a0ef46f54a079a733fd786c3333c OP_EQUAL
address
MMntEd7Gx377Y9oVz8fydBU6a29uP4tStc
transaction
579e60d5ef9ed6fd518347bb8c72fc24b772705f3ac32e63d11829d1b6f222e6
spent
true